The arduino micro sometimes fails to show up as a COM port #2373

Description

It appears that the driver for the arduino micro fails intermittently. I get the error message "Windows has stopped this device because it has reported problems. (Code 43)". At the point I took the screenshot I had 3 arduino micros plugged into my computer, 2 of which showed up as COM ports and 1 of which shows as an unknown device.

The number of arduino micros that windows recognises has varied over time so I don't think that this is a hardware error.

I am running arduino 1.5.8 on windows 7 64 bit. I have installed the latest drivers available.(I attach a screenshot of me looking at the driver update).

Background: I am polling a pressure sensor over I2C and streaming the data back to a windows PC.
